AI账号自动化管理:从临时邮箱到负载均衡的完整解决方案
1. 项目概述一个AI账号自动化管理的“瑞士军刀”如果你正在或计划大规模使用ChatGPT、Claude、Gemini这类AI服务那么账号的注册、管理和维护绝对是一个绕不开的痛点。手动注册不仅效率低下面对复杂的验证流程、临时的邮箱需求以及后续的Token管理更是让人头疼。今天要聊的这个开源项目——AI-Account-Toolkit就是为解决这些痛点而生的。它不是一个单一的工具而是一个汇集了超过40个独立模块的“工具箱”覆盖了从账号批量注册、临时邮箱服务、API密钥管理到负载均衡等几乎所有你能想到的自动化场景。简单来说它把AI账号运营中那些重复、繁琐且需要技术门槛的工作封装成了一个个可以开箱即用或二次开发的脚本和工具。无论你是开发者需要为项目构建稳定的AI服务调用池还是研究者需要批量创建实验账号亦或是普通用户想更高效地管理自己的多个AI账号这个工具集都能提供强大的助力。它的核心价值在于“集成”与“自动化”将散落在各处的解决方案聚合在一起并提供了统一的入口和相互协作的可能性。2. 核心模块深度解析与选型指南面对工具集里琳琅满目的40多个子项目新手很容易感到无从下手。关键在于理解它们的功能分类和适用场景。我们可以将其核心能力拆解为几个关键链条每个链条上的工具可以组合使用形成自动化流水线。2.1 账号注册链从邮箱到Token的全流程这是最核心的链条目标是输入一批邮箱或自动生成邮箱输出可用的API Token。工具集提供了多种路径路径一基于临时邮箱的纯协议注册以GPT-team和GPT_registerduckmailCPAautouploadsub2api为代表。这类工具不依赖图形化浏览器直接通过模拟HTTP请求与OpenAI的后端API进行交互。其工作流程通常是邮箱获取调用DuckMail等临时邮箱服务API获取一个可用的邮箱地址。注册请求向OpenAI的注册接口发送请求完成账号创建。邮箱验证轮询临时邮箱抓取验证链接或验证码。Token获取完成验证后通过OAuth或会话接口获取账号的Access Token。结果上报可选地将获取到的Token自动上传到如Sub2Api这样的Token管理平台。实操心得协议注册的优势是速度快、资源消耗低适合在服务器上无头运行。但缺点是对目标网站的反爬机制非常敏感一旦OpenAI更新了注册接口或验证逻辑脚本就可能失效。因此这类工具需要维护者持续跟进更新。路径二基于浏览器自动化的高仿真注册以codex-register-V2和codex-oauth-automation-extension为代表。这类工具使用Selenium、Playwright或Puppeteer等浏览器自动化框架真实地打开浏览器模拟人类操作。codex-register-V2甚至集成了Browserbase这样的云端浏览器服务可以绕过本地环境限制和部分指纹检测。浏览器扩展则直接在Chrome中运行能更自然地处理Cookie、本地存储和复杂的JavaScript交互。注意事项浏览器自动化方案的注册成功率通常更高更能应对复杂的验证码如Cloudflare Turnstile。但代价是速度慢、占用资源多且对网络环境特别是IP质量要求极高。通常需要配合高质量的代理IP池使用。路径三针对特定平台的专用工具例如packages/grok/grok-register专门用于x.aiGrok的注册packages/cursor/cursor-auto-register针对Cursor编辑器。这些工具因为目标明确通常集成了针对该平台的反反爬策略和特有的流程处理成功率比通用工具更高。选型建议追求效率和规模优先尝试协议注册工具如GPT-team但需准备好应对可能的失效问题并关注项目更新。追求成功率和稳定性在IP质量有保障的前提下使用浏览器自动化方案如codex-register-V2。针对特定平台直接使用该平台的专用工具。混合使用可以先用协议工具快速尝试失败的任务再用浏览器工具进行“补刀”。2.2 邮箱服务链自动化流程的基石稳定的邮箱供应是批量注册的命脉。工具集提供了从使用公共API到自建服务的全套方案。1. 公共临时邮箱API集成多个注册工具内置了对如DuckMail、MailTM等公共临时邮箱服务的支持。这些服务开箱即用无需维护但存在可用性不稳定、域名可能被目标网站屏蔽、取信延迟等问题。2. 自托管临时邮箱服务packages/email/tempmail项目是这里的重头戏。它允许你搭建自己的临时邮箱系统。核心优势域名可控可以购买一批“干净”的域名用于注册极大提高通过率邮件收取速度快无API限制。技术栈基于Docker Compose整合了Postfix发/收邮件、PostgreSQL存储、Redis缓存、以及一个Web管理后台和API服务。部署考量自建服务需要一台拥有公网IP的服务器并正确配置域名的MX记录。这对运维有一定要求但换来的是完全自主可控的邮箱基础设施。3. 商业邮箱自动化packages/email/hotmail-outlook-auto-register等项目则走了另一条路自动化创建和管理Outlook、Hotmail这类真实的、长期可用的邮箱。这解决了临时邮箱生命周期短的问题但自动化创建真实邮箱的难度和风险都更高更容易触发微软的风控。4. 邮箱聚合与管理merge-mailtm-share和mailhub等目录则提供了一些邮箱账号分享、聚合管理的思路或资源可以作为邮箱来源的补充。避坑指南不要把所有鸡蛋放在一个篮子里。在实际操作中建议采用“自建域名邮箱为主多个公共临时邮箱API为辅”的策略。为不同的AI服务平台配置不同的邮箱域名可以有效隔离风险。2.3 账号管理与运维链注册之后的持久战账号注册成功只是第一步后续的维护、监控和高效利用同样重要。1. Token与账号池管理openai_pool_orchestrator-V6这是一个功能强大的账号池编排器。它可以管理成千上万个OpenAI账号的Token实现自动化的心跳检测检查Token是否有效、负载均衡、自动剔除失效账号、甚至自动续期或重新注册。packages/claude/claude-key-switch和packages/codex/codex-lb提供了针对Claude和Codex API的密钥轮换与负载均衡功能确保在调用频率限制下也能稳定服务。2. 账号状态检查与清理CPAtools专门用于批量检查Codex账号的健康状态自动清理那些已经失效返回401错误的账号保持账号池的“纯洁性”。3. Web控制台与任务调度packages/general/mregister它将命令行脚本包装成了一个Web UI。你可以在网页上提交注册任务、查看任务队列、下载生成的结果并且所有任务状态都被持久化。这对于团队协作和长时间批量作业非常友好。4. 周边支持工具packages/general/real-random-taxfree-address生成真实的美国免税州地址用于需要填写账单信息的场景。ClashVerge_提供代理配置脚本帮助管理注册所需的网络出口IP。FreeSMS收集了免费接码平台资源用于应对需要手机号验证的环节尽管在AI账号注册中相对少用。3. 实战部署以搭建自托管邮箱和自动注册为例理论讲完了我们来实操一条经典的自动化流水线使用自建临时邮箱服务通过浏览器自动化方式批量注册OpenAI账号并纳入账号池管理。3.1 第一阶段部署自托管临时邮箱服务Tempmail我们选择packages/email/tempmail因为它功能完整自带管理界面。步骤1环境准备准备一台Linux服务器Ubuntu 22.04为例安装好Docker和Docker Compose。确保服务器80/443端口开放并拥有一个可以配置DNS的域名例如yourdomain.com。步骤2获取代码与配置# 进入项目邮箱模块目录 cd AI-Account-Toolkit/packages/email/tempmail # 复制环境变量示例文件并编辑 cp .env.example .env编辑.env文件关键配置如下# 设置你的主域名 DOMAINyourdomain.com # 用于管理后台的密钥 SECRET_KEYyour_very_strong_secret_key_here # 数据库密码 POSTGRES_PASSWORDstrong_db_password # Redis密码 REDIS_PASSWORDstrong_redis_password # 邮件发送配置可选用于发送通知 MAIL_FROMnoreplyyourdomain.com # 如果需要用SMTP发信配置以下 # SMTP_HOSTsmtp.gmail.com # SMTP_PORT587 # SMTP_USERyour-emailgmail.com # SMTP_PASSWORDyour-app-password步骤3配置DNS你需要为邮箱服务添加DNS记录。假设你希望用mail.yourdomain.com作为邮箱服务地址用*.mail.yourdomain.com作为临时邮箱域名。A记录将mail.yourdomain.com指向你的服务器IP。MX记录将*.mail.yourdomain.com的MX记录指向mail.yourdomain.com优先级为10。重要提示MX记录的生效需要时间通常为几分钟到几小时。在生效前邮箱无法正常收信。步骤4启动服务# 使用docker-compose启动所有服务 docker-compose up -d启动后访问https://mail.yourdomain.com即可看到管理后台。首次登录需要注册管理员账号。步骤5添加可用域名并创建邮箱在管理后台的“域名”页面添加一个用于注册的域名例如ai-users.mail.yourdomain.com。系统会自动检查其MX记录是否配置正确。 验证通过后你就可以在“邮箱”页面创建邮箱地址了比如test001ai-users.mail.yourdomain.com。每个邮箱都有一个收件箱地址注册工具将通过API来轮询这个收件箱获取验证邮件。步骤6获取API密钥在后台生成一个API Key后续的注册脚本将使用这个Key来调用Tempmail的API实现创建邮箱、读取邮件的功能。3.2 第二阶段配置并运行浏览器自动化注册机我们以codex-register-V2为例它功能强大支持远程浏览器。步骤1环境准备cd AI-Account-Toolkit/codex-register-V2 pip install -r requirements.txt该项目依赖Playwright还需要安装浏览器playwright install chromium步骤2核心配置解析项目根目录通常有config.yaml或config.example.json。你需要配置以下几个核心部分# 示例配置片段 email_service: type: tempmail # 指定使用我们自建的服务 api_url: https://mail.yourdomain.com/api/v1 api_key: your_tempmail_api_key_here domain: ai-users.mail.yourdomain.com # 使用的域名 browserbase: enabled: true # 是否使用Browserbase云端浏览器 api_key: your_browserbase_api_key # 如果没有可设为false使用本地浏览器 # 使用云端浏览器能更好地隐藏指纹但需要付费 proxy: enabled: true # 代理配置至关重要必须使用高质量、纯净的住宅IP代理。 # 格式可以是 http://user:passhost:port 或 socks5://... list: [ http://proxy1.example.com:8080, http://proxy2.example.com:8080 ] openai: # 注册目标可能是普通账号或Team账号 register_type: team # 邀请链接如果需要 invite_link: https://chat.openai.com/invite/xxx...步骤3理解两阶段注册流程codex-register-V2的流程设计得很细致分为两个阶段这提高了容错率阶段一注册使用Browserbase或本地浏览器配合代理IP完成邮箱注册、验证、设置密码等步骤得到一个可登录的账号。此阶段结束后账号信息邮箱、密码会被保存下来。阶段二OAuth授权使用另一个独立的脚本或流程登录上一步注册的账号并完成OAuth授权流程最终获取到可用于API调用的Token。实操心得将注册和获取Token分离是明智的。因为注册过程风控最严容易失败而获取Token的过程相对稳定。这样即使注册中途失败也不会浪费已经获取到的Token。你可以先批量运行阶段一积累一批成功注册的账号然后再统一运行阶段二获取Token。步骤4运行与监控# 运行阶段一的注册脚本 python phase1_register.py --config config.yaml运行后脚本会自动打开浏览器或连接远程浏览器按照预设流程操作。你可以在控制台看到详细的日志包括当前步骤、遇到的错误等。成功标志控制台输出“Registration successful for email: xxxxxx”并在本地生成一个registered_accounts.json文件。常见失败原因代理IP被屏蔽、邮箱域名被目标网站拒绝、验证码识别失败、网络超时。3.3 第三阶段将Token纳入账号池统一管理注册成功并获取到Token后我们需要将其导入到账号池进行长效管理。步骤1部署账号池编排器cd AI-Account-Toolkit/openai_pool_orchestrator-V6 pip install -r requirements.txt编辑其配置文件设置数据库如SQLite或MySQL、Token存储路径、健康检查间隔等。步骤2导入Token将codex-register-V2输出的Token通常是一个文本文件每行一个Token或JSON格式通过账号池编排器提供的API或管理界面导入。# 假设编排器提供了导入脚本 python import_tokens.py --file ../codex-register-V2/output/tokens.txt --pool-name openai_main步骤3配置负载均衡与健康检查在账号池的管理界面或配置文件中你可以设置健康检查频率如每30分钟检查一次所有Token是否有效。配置负载均衡策略如随机、轮询、基于剩余额度的权重分配等。设置告警当有效Token数低于某个阈值时发送邮件或Webhook通知。步骤4集成到你的应用账号池通常会提供一个统一的API端点。你的应用程序不再直接使用原始的OpenAI API Key而是向这个账号池的API发起请求。池子会帮你自动选择一个可用的Token并在Token失效时自动切换。# 伪代码示例通过账号池调用ChatGPT import requests # 向你的账号池网关发送请求 response requests.post( http://your-pool-gateway:8080/v1/chat/completions, headers{Authorization: Bearer YOUR_POOL_ACCESS_KEY}, json{ model: gpt-3.5-turbo, messages: [{role: user, content: Hello}] } )这样你就构建了一个从邮箱供应、自动化注册到Token管理、负载调用的完整闭环系统。4. 常见问题、风险与合规性探讨在享受自动化便利的同时我们必须清醒地认识到其中的风险与挑战。4.1 技术层面的常见故障排查问题现象可能原因排查步骤与解决方案注册成功率骤降1. 代理IP质量差或被大规模封禁。2. 使用的邮箱域名被目标平台拉黑。3. 注册脚本逻辑已过时无法应对网站改版。1.更换代理IP池测试单个IP的手动注册成功率确保IP干净。2.更换邮箱域名临时邮箱域名寿命有限需定期更换新域名。3.更新脚本关注项目GitHub的Issue和更新或自行调试修改请求参数。浏览器自动化卡在验证码1. 触发了更复杂的验证码如Cloudflare Turnstile。2. 浏览器指纹被识别为自动化工具。1.使用更真实的浏览器环境启用Browserbase或在本机使用带完整用户数据目录的浏览器。2.降低并发和频率过快的操作速率极易触发风控。3.考虑人工介入设计流程将验证码截图并通过API发送到人工打码平台。无法收到验证邮件1. 邮箱服务MX记录未生效或配置错误。2. 目标网站的发信被延迟或拦截。3. 临时邮箱的收信API故障。1.检查DNS使用dig MX your-email-domain.com命令确认MX记录。2.检查垃圾邮件箱有时验证邮件会被分类到垃圾箱。3.直接登录邮箱Web界面查看绕过API确认邮箱服务本身是否正常。Token获取失败4011. 注册流程未完全完成账号状态异常。2. 获取Token的OAuth流程有变更。3. 账号已被封禁。1.手动登录验证用注册的邮箱密码尝试手动登录网页版确认账号正常。2.检查OAuth流程使用浏览器开发者工具抓取最新的OAuth请求参数。3.查看官方状态关注OpenAI等平台的服务状态和公告。4.2 法律与合规风险警示这是使用此类工具集必须严肃对待的部分。1. 违反服务条款OpenAI、Anthropic、Google等公司的用户协议中几乎都明确禁止“自动化创建账号”、“创建多个账号以规避使用限制”等行为。使用这些工具批量注册账号本质上违反了服务条款。潜在后果轻则批量注册的账号被立即封禁导致投入的代理、邮箱成本血本无归。重则可能导致你的主要IP地址、支付方式甚至真实身份关联的账号被连带封禁。风控对抗的代价平台的风控系统在不断升级工具集的维护是一种持续的“军备竞赛”。你今天有效的脚本明天可能就完全失效。2. 数据安全与隐私风险敏感信息泄露配置文件中可能包含代理IP的账号密码、邮箱服务的API Key、甚至云服务商的密钥。一旦代码仓库设置不当如误上传.env文件或服务器被入侵将导致严重泄露。恶意使用风险此类工具若被用于制造垃圾账号、进行欺诈或发送垃圾信息工具提供者和使用者都可能承担法律责任。3. 伦理考量大规模自动化创建AI账号可能会被用于刷取API额度进行商业滥用。制造虚假的交互数据干扰平台生态。进行网络攻击的辅助工作如生成钓鱼邮件。核心建议仅将此类工具用于个人学习、研究以及在服务条款允许范围内的自动化辅助。例如管理自己为数不多的几个合法账号的Token或者在小规模、低频率的测试环境中使用。绝对不要用于任何可能对服务提供商或其他用户造成损害的商业或滥用行为。4.3 可持续使用的策略如果你有合法的、小规模的使用需求希望尽可能长久地使用这些工具以下策略可供参考模拟人类行为在浏览器自动化脚本中增加随机延迟、模拟鼠标移动轨迹、使用真实的浏览器指纹如通过Browserbase。使用优质资源投资高质量的住宅代理IP、使用自己注册的而非公开的邮箱域名、避免使用虚拟信用卡等易被标记的支付方式。控制规模与频率将批量操作打散模拟自然用户的注册时间和频率。不要试图在短时间内注册成百上千个账号。关注官方动态加入相关社区关注目标平台的政策变化和技术更新及时调整你的工具和策略。准备备用方案不要依赖单一的工具或注册通道。了解多种注册方法并在主要方法失效时有能力快速切换。这个工具集展示了自动化技术的强大力量但它更像是一把锋利的“手术刀”而非“砍柴刀”。如何使用它取决于持有者的意图与智慧。在技术探索的道路上始终保持对规则的敬畏将工具用于提高效率、解决实际问题的正道才是长久之计。